Dental implants have turn into a focus in modern dentistry, providing a dependable answer for those dealing with tooth loss. Among the a number of benefits they offer, one vital side worth contemplating is their impact on adjacent teeth. Understanding how dental implants affect surrounding teeth aids in making knowledgeable decisions about oral health.
When a tooth is misplaced, neighboring teeth can easily shift toward the house left behind. This movement can result in misalignment, which compromises the general bite and performance of the mouth. Dental implants mimic natural tooth roots, thereby sustaining the place of adjacent teeth.

The stability provided by an implant is essential, because it helps in preserving not just the physical alignment but additionally the structural integrity of the jawbone. When a tooth is missing, the underlying bone can start to deteriorate because of lack of stimulation. An implant exerts pressure on the bone throughout chewing, much like a natural tooth, which promotes bone health.
In some cases, a bridge or partial denture could additionally be thought of as a substitute for implants. While these options might restore some functionality, they can place further stress on neighboring teeth. Bridges normally require submitting down the encompassing teeth to accommodate the anchors, thereby affecting their health over time. Dental implants, on the opposite hand, don't alter current teeth, making them a extra conservative selection.

Hygiene turns into one other important issue when considering adjacent teeth in the context of implants. With dental implants, the person can preserve an everyday hygiene routine similar to natural teeth. Flossing and brushing around the implant are simple, ensuring that the gum tissue stays wholesome and minimizing the risk of gum disease that would adversely have an result on adjacent teeth.
Moreover, the supplies utilized in dental implants are biocompatible. This means they're designed to combine nicely with the physique, decreasing the probabilities of an opposed response. This attribute not solely makes the implant secure but additionally protects close by teeth from potential issues that could arise because of contamination or infection.
